MongoDB是一个基于文档存储的非关系型数据库management system,它具有快速开发的特点,广受开发者的青睐,普及了非关系型数据库的使用。MongoDB 以其易扩大、弹性和可横向扩大的特点,遭到了众多大企业和组织的青睐。
与关系型数据库区别,MongoDB其实不需要提早定义数据库中的表结构。它通过不断增加更多的文档来立即满足后续使用者的需求,有效地减少了开发者的设计本钱和开发时间,使用者可以很容易就可以够开发出高性能 利用程序。另外,MongoDB 有着良好的索引功能,使用者可以方便的访问文档并更改内容,对文档的查询更加快捷高效。
由于MongoDB使用文档存储,因此它具有更高的存储空间利用率,可以灵活地将大量信息聚合在一起,提供根据多项条件进行查询的功能,使大量数据能够在短时间内被处理终了。另外,MongoDB具有良好的扩大性,它能够更好的应对各种复杂的散布式计算,使用者没必要担心集群中的复杂性所带来的挑战。
MongoDB在利用开发领域的高度普及,是由于它高性能的查询及存储速度、可靠的索引技术及横向扩大、高效的空间利用率和完备的安全功能,使得MongoDB能够满足各种大中小型机构及企业对各种数据存储、复杂数据统计对利用开发的需求,使用MongoDB已成为愈来愈多公司及机构首选的数据库解决方案之一。
总而言之,MongoDB 普及了非关系型数据库的使用,其实不断吸引着众多使用者的眼球,它的发展日趋复杂的信息场景,将进一步推动着数据库技术的发展。例如,MongoDB能够支持复杂的查询,如聚合查询,用户可以很容易的使用MongoDB完成一些复杂的数据查询。另外,MongoDB还支持索引、触发器和存储进程,这些功能可在某些场景中发挥很大的作用。
本文来源:https://www.yuntue.com/post/221135.html | 云服务器网,转载请注明出处!

微信扫一扫打赏
支付宝扫一扫打赏